How We Calculate This

Transfer recommendations factor in form trajectory over the last 5 gameweeks, fixture swing across the next 6 matches (avg FDR: 3.0), price change probability based on net transfer volume (0 this GW), and ownership trends among all managers. The buy score combines current form, points per 90 minutes, fixture difficulty, and transfer momentum into a 0–100 confidence rating. Alternatives are filtered to the same position within ±£1.5m of Palmer's price and ranked by recent form. All data sourced from the official FPL API, refreshed every 3 hours.
